Full Job Posting

Responsibilities

  • Drive full-lifecycle recruiting and end-to-end talent acquisition across critical non-technical and technical roles (including Program Managers, Software Engineering, and People Partners) in London and the EMEA region.
  • Build strong relationships with key stakeholders, operating as a trusted advisor to influence hiring strategies, leveling, and location decisions.
  • Leverage data, market intelligence, and talent insights to diagnose hiring bottlenecks, reduce process inefficiencies, and ensure pipelines are representative.
  • Provide an exceptional, fair, and positive experience, role-modeling DeepMind’s values both internally and externally.
  • Cultivate networks of high-potential, passive talent to meet future business demands.

Minimum qualifications:

5 years of experience in full-cycle recruiting or talent acquisition, in an agency or corporate setting.

Experience in stakeholder and project management.

Preferred qualifications:

Experience managing full-lifecycle recruiting and end-to-end talent acquisition across technical and non-technical domains across the EMEA region.

Experience utilising talent analytics, market intelligence, and data insights to identify pipeline bottlenecks, streamline recruiting workflows, and build representative applicant pools.

Ability to cultivate stakeholder partnerships and serve as a trusted advisor to influence hiring strategies, leveling, and location decisions.

Demonstrated ability to advocate a fair and high-touch applicant experience while upholding organizational values internally and externally.
